Apple is reportedly collaborating with AI research company Anthropic to build a next-generation software development platform that uses generative AI to write, edit, and test code, according to Bloomberg. The new system, internally referred to as a “vibe-coding” platform, is based on Apple’s Xcode and powered by Anthropic’s Claude Sonnet model.
While the tool is currently intended for internal use, Apple has not ruled out a public release. The move signals Apple’s growing reliance on external AI models, including OpenAI’s ChatGPT and potentially Google’s Gemini, to enhance its suite of Apple Intelligence tools. Anthropic’s Claude models have gained traction among developers for their strength in automated code generation and analysis.
